本文目录导读:
随着云计算技术的飞速发展,云服务器已经成为企业、个人用户获取计算资源的重要途径,在实际使用过程中,云服务器IOPS(每秒输入/输出操作数)限制成为了许多用户关注的焦点,本文将从云服务器IOPS限制的原因、影响以及优化策略等方面进行深入剖析,帮助用户更好地理解和应对这一问题。
云服务器IOPS限制的原因
1、物理存储设备性能限制
云服务器通常采用分布式存储架构,而物理存储设备(如硬盘、SSD等)的性能是影响IOPS的关键因素,当存储设备的性能达到瓶颈时,IOPS就会受到限制。
图片来源于网络,如有侵权联系删除
2、云服务提供商资源分配策略
为了保障所有用户的权益,云服务提供商会对云服务器的资源进行分配限制,IOPS限制是其中之一,以确保系统稳定性和性能。
3、虚拟化技术限制
虚拟化技术是实现云服务器的基础,但虚拟化层也会对IOPS产生一定影响,虚拟化层会对物理资源进行抽象和封装,从而降低IOPS性能。
4、网络延迟
云服务器之间的数据传输需要经过网络,网络延迟会影响IOPS性能,当网络带宽不足或延迟过高时,IOPS就会受到限制。
云服务器IOPS限制的影响
1、性能下降
IOPS限制会导致云服务器在处理大量读写操作时,性能下降,这将直接影响业务运行效率,降低用户体验。
2、资源浪费
当云服务器IOPS限制时,用户可能会购买更高规格的云服务器以满足需求,从而导致资源浪费。
3、业务中断
图片来源于网络,如有侵权联系删除
在某些对IOPS要求较高的业务场景中,如数据库、文件存储等,IOPS限制可能导致业务中断,影响企业运营。
云服务器IOPS优化策略
1、选择合适的云服务器规格
在购买云服务器时,根据实际需求选择合适的规格,避免过度购买或购买不足。
2、优化存储配置
针对存储配置,可采取以下优化措施:
(1)使用SSD存储:SSD具有更高的IOPS性能,可以有效提升云服务器的读写速度。
(2)调整存储队列深度:适当增加存储队列深度,可以提高IOPS性能。
(3)合理分配存储资源:将数据合理分配到不同的存储设备上,避免单点性能瓶颈。
3、优化应用程序
针对应用程序,可采取以下优化措施:
(1)优化数据库:通过优化查询语句、索引、缓存等技术,提高数据库性能。
图片来源于网络,如有侵权联系删除
(2)使用分布式存储:将数据分散存储在多个节点上,提高IOPS性能。
(3)优化网络:提高网络带宽,降低网络延迟,从而提升IOPS性能。
4、使用缓存技术
通过使用缓存技术,如Redis、Memcached等,可以减少对存储设备的访问频率,从而降低IOPS压力。
5、调整虚拟化参数
针对虚拟化技术,可调整以下参数:
(1)CPU亲和性:将虚拟机绑定到特定的CPU核心,提高IOPS性能。
(2)内存分配:合理分配虚拟机的内存资源,避免内存不足导致IOPS下降。
云服务器IOPS限制是云计算领域常见的问题,了解其产生原因、影响及优化策略,有助于用户更好地应对这一问题,通过合理配置云服务器资源、优化应用程序和存储配置,可以有效提升云服务器的IOPS性能,保障业务稳定运行。
标签: #云服务器iops限制
评论列表